Years ago, when the CZ 75 9MM pistol first sold in the U.S. - I was very interested in the Sig 210 but couldn't find or afford one.
The storied Sig 210 9MM pistol was regarded as the ultimate 9MM pistol in quality, ergonomics, and accuracy.
When the CZ 75 first debuted - a lot of favorable comparisons were soon made between the Sig 210 and CZ 75. Both pistols
featured the slide running inside of the rails of the frame - instead of vice-versa, which may set the barrel somewhat lower.
My first CZ was a CZ 85 Combat 9mm pistol - Exactly like the CZ 75, but with ambidextrous controls on both sides of the pistol,
adjustable sights, and adjustable trigger. If you are looking for a quality 9MM pistol like a Sig 210 - check out CZ!
The CZ 75 is the CZ flagship model, but every other CZ pistol is of the same inherent design.
I did acquire a Sig 210 Target 9MM pistol and it is a dream come true. Later I picked up another CZ 85 which I took
out with some friends, shooting last fall - They were amazed with how well they shot, and the CZ pistol performed.
